1. Introduction to the Minecraft Launcher
The Minecraft Launcher is the software that acts as a bridge between players and the game itself. It provides the essential tools and functionalities required to launch the game, manage updates, and access additional content, ensuring a smooth and immersive experience for players.
2. The Key Functions
At its core, the Minecraft Launcher performs several key functions that contribute to a seamless gameplay experience:
Game Launching: The most fundamental function of the launcher is to start the Minecraft game. With a single click, players are transported to the pixelated landscapes where they can create, explore, and embark on their unique adventures.
Authentication: The launcher is responsible for authenticating players, ensuring that only authorized users can access the game. This adds a layer of security and protection to the Minecraft community.
Account Management: The launcher enables players to manage their accounts, change their skins, and adjust personal settings. This customization allows players to express their individuality within the game.
Update Management: As Minecraft continues to evolve, updates and patches are released to enhance gameplay, introduce new features, and fix bugs. The launcher facilitates the seamless download and installation of these updates, ensuring players always have access to the latest version of the game.
3. Accessibility to Different Versions
One of the notable features of the Minecraft Launcher is its ability to access different versions of the game. Players can choose from various editions and snapshots, allowing them to experience Minecraft in its original form or explore experimental features in the latest snapshots.
